Lahti's Radio Dei occupies an interesting position in Finland's radio ecology - it's independent enough to maintain distinct programming while connected enough to access content most local stations can't reach. The format privileges contemporary music but doesn't ignore Finnish music heritage. Nordic artists get priority in ways national stations sometimes neglect. Finnish music culture has evolved considerably; the country's punch above its weight in metal, electronic music, and indie rock.
